About the Job
Duties and Responsibilities
- Serves as a liaison for owner and partner entities for the contract, design systems, procedures and related deliverables.
- Demonstrates functional knowledge of contracts, drawings, estimates, and specifications to ensure compliance with construction/project requirements.
- Obtains, maintains and manages data, information, communications, and approvals required by project and company requirements between owner, architects, engineers, and other project-related entities.
- May represent owner, project and related parties in public forums and meetings.
- Manages project controls, cost and performance activities and procedures, procurement, project logistics, organization, systems and project close-out.
- May lead project meetings.
- Documents and tracks relevant information and project statuses.
- May coordinate, direct, and monitor activities of construction management staff, contractors, engineers,
- architects, and related performing entities.
- ยท Other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
Minimum Requirements
- Bachelor's Degree in construction management, engineering, architecture, or equivalent degree.
- 5-10 years of progressive project management experience.
- Experience with construction management processes and knowledge of construction means and methods.
- Knowledge of project delivery and time management, and how to deal with unanticipated events and unforeseen conditions.
Preferred Qualifications
- Strong written and verbal communication skills and computer skills.
- Proficient in reading and understanding contract documents, plans and specifications.
- Proficient using Microsoft Office Suite, MS Project and/or Primavera.
- Ability to work independently to achieve client goals.
- Understanding of project financing sources, issues, and practices
